Please Note: Ethiopian opals are hydrophane and can absorb moisture. Water exposure (including during cutting) may temporarily affect their appearance, but as the stone dries, its color will naturally return over time. These opals should be stored in a dry environment. Avoid prolonged exposure to oils or chemicals, as oils can be absorbed and may permanently affect the appearance.
